Crusoes is an exceptional riverside residence, offering a rare opportunity to acquire a beautifully presented detached family home complete with a self-contained one-bedroom annexe. Set within nearly one and a quarter acres of meticulously landscaped gardens, the grounds also feature a tranquil water garden with a private mooring, and an enchanting wooded island—all nestled along the serene banks of Womack Water.

Enjoying panoramic views across this picturesque stretch of the Norfolk Broads, Crusoes is a true sanctuary—perfect for those seeking peace, privacy, and a connection to nature, whether as a full-time home or an idyllic retreat.

Tucked away at the fringe of the sought-after Broadland village of Ludham, this exceptional home enjoys a peaceful setting within the heart of the Norfolk Broads National Park. Womack Water, a picturesque offshoot of the River Thurne, offers direct access to the renowned waterways and lies within easy reach of Horning (four miles) and Wroxham (seven miles).

Set back from the road and screened by mature hedging, the property is approached via a driveway leading to a double garage with workshop and gated entrance into a spacious area providing ample off-road parking. To the rear, a generous sun terrace leads onto a manicured south-east facing lawn, bordered by mature trees and vibrant planting. A picturesque pathway leads to a serene river garden and a private mooring—perfect for accessing the tranquil Womack Water. Beyond, a secluded wooded island offers a rare and enchanting natural retreat.

Inside, the main house delivers expansive and versatile accommodation of nearly four and a half thousand square feet of living space. An enclosed porch opens into a welcoming hallway, with separate doors to four reception rooms including a formal dining room, home office easily converted into a bedroom, a stylish kitchen/breakfast room with adjoining snug, and a spacious family lounge with multiple French doors opening to the garden—inviting in natural light and panoramic views.

The self-contained annexe, accessible from the main hallway, offers superb multi-generational living or guest accommodation. It comprises an open-plan kitchen/lounge/diner with garden access, a cloakroom, and a double bedroom with a walk-in wardrobe and en-suite shower room.

Upstairs, a wide landing with a study nook leads to four double bedrooms, three of which benefit from en-suite facilities, offering privacy and comfort for family or guests.

This stunning property is further enhanced by its idyllic location down a country lane in Ludham. The village offers a selection of amenities including a primary school, local shops, doctors’ surgery, and traditional pubs. The North Norfolk coastline lies less than ten miles away, and the cathedral city of Norwich—offering first-class shopping, restaurants, cultural attractions, the University of East Anglia, and the Norfolk and Norwich University Hospital—is just fourteen miles to the south.
